Lionel Messi pushing world-class United star to leave Old Trafford for CL club, player is unhappy under Amorim – report


Manchester United have missed Lisandro Martinez in that left centre-back position since his ACL injury last season.

Leny Yoro did admirably in that position at times last term, but he is not left-footed. Which is why Ruben Amorim has played Luke Shaw there this campaign.

The head coach would love for the Argentine to return soon, with the World Cup winner already training on grass, which indicates a return is not too far away.

But there have been murmurs that the ex-Ajax ace could be played as a defensive midfielder once he does make a comeback, due to the dearth of options in that position.

Casemiro is no longer the force he once was, while Manuel Ugarte has struggled big time since his much-hyped move to Old Trafford last year.

The Argentina international is no stranger to playing at the base of the midfielder, but he might not enjoy this positional change.

And as a result, rumours of an exit have gathered pace with Barcelona among the interested suitors.

Reports in Spain have suggested that it is Martinez’ national teammate and Barca legend Lionel Messi, who is pushing for the left-footed centre-half to move to the Camp Nou.

Messi is aware of the Catalans’ need for a left-footed defender, and he is pushing his compatriot’s case to Deco and Hansi Flick. He will be a far more cost-effective signing as compared to Alessandro Bastoni.

“Julian Alvarez is not the only player from the ‘Albiceleste’ team who has been recommended by the former Paris Saint-Germain player, who is also convinced that Lisandro Martínez could be an exceptional reinforcement in every sense.

“Messi knows Barça is looking for a left-footed center back, after having to let Íñigo Martínez leave a few weeks ago, after he signed for Al-Nassr of Saudi Arabia, in order to reduce their wage bill.

“This caused a significant headache for Hans-Dieter Flick, who doesn’t fully trust either Andreas Christensen or Ronald Araújo to be Pau Cubarsí’s new partner. And Gerard Martín has been re-signed, but he also raises many questions.

“Laporta and Deco intend to sign a top-level defender in the summer of 2026, and Leo has suggested they opt for the Manchester United player, who is unhappy with Rubén Amorim’s project due to the poor results obtained.

“However, despite Messi’s recommendations, Barça remains very clear that the ideal candidate to complete the defensive lineup is Inter Milan’s Alessandro Bastoni. But if his price doesn’t fit their budget, Laporta and Deco could opt for Lisandro, who would be more affordable.”

While the 27-year-old’s recent injury record is not the best, when fit, Lisandro Martinez is easily the best defender available to the head coach, especially with his ability on the ball.

None of the back three possess the line-breaking passing ability, while his tenaciousness and fighting spirit is something the team could do with when under pressure. INEOS better be careful to avoid such a scenario from playing out in the future.
